On Tuesday, the University of Wisconsin-Whitewater baseball team defeated Emory 7-0 and in doing so claimed the Division III national championship. Here's the celebratory scrum ...

That's news enough, but it so happens that earlier this year the Warhawks also won the D-III national title in football and men's basketball. That's the first time in NCAA history that a school has pulled off the major-sport trifecta in the same year.
